Understanding Potassium Sorbate

Potassium sorbate is the potassium salt of sorbic acid and is often used to inhibit the growth of mold, yeast, and some bacteria. It is classified as a food additive with the E number E202. The compound is recognized for its antimicrobial properties, making it suitable for use in various food products, including dairy, beverages, and baked goods. According to the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), potassium sorbate is generally recognized as safe (GRAS) when used in appropriate amounts.

2. Safe and Effective

Safety is paramount when it comes to food additives. Potassium sorbate has been extensively studied and is recognized as safe by both the FDA and the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A). Studies demonstrate that it does not pose any significant health risks when consumed in regulated amounts. According to the EFSA, the acceptable daily intake (ADI) of potassium sorbate is set at 0–25 mg/kg body weight.
